    Strategic Analysis of the Plastics Market in the ASEAN Automotive Industry

    Under-the-Hood and Exterior Applications Will Open Up Metal Substitution Opportunities

    The automotive plastics market in ASEAN has experienced strong growth in the past few years. Thailand, Indonesia, and Malaysia are the automotive manufacturing hubs of this particular region and are responsible for the overall growth of the automotive plastics market.
